Output b599de54ae90bc1787e76b7d885bf2c4f6ce450871ae715f497acef1e9a761e6:1

value
360862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a811d507fb7fadf6c70b59e4ecfba94ed2a855b OP_EQUAL
address
3BQADuoSyFRny3Lih5E9ETz7r1hCFjL7nw
transaction
b599de54ae90bc1787e76b7d885bf2c4f6ce450871ae715f497acef1e9a761e6
confirmations
354649
spent
true